Tragic Violence Claims Lives of Three York County Officers

In a shocking turn of events, three police officers in York County, Pennsylvania, lost their lives while responding to a domestic-related investigation. This senseless act of violence has sent ripples of grief and outrage through the community and beyond, highlighting the dangers law enforcement faces daily, particularly in volatile situations involving domestic disputes.

The incident unfolded as officers were dispatched to a residence where domestic disturbances had been reported. Upon arrival, they were met with an unexpected and violent confrontation, resulting in the tragic deaths of three dedicated officers. Two other officers sustained injuries and were rushed to local hospitals, where they are currently receiving treatment. The identities of the fallen officers have not yet been released, as authorities are still notifying their families.

Witnesses described the scene as chaotic and terrifying. Neighbors reported hearing multiple gunshots and the sounds of sirens in quick succession. The heart-wrenching news prompted an immediate response from local and state officials. Governor Josh Shapiro addressed the media, emphasizing the need for society to confront the issue of violence head-on. “This kind of violence isn’t okay,” he stated firmly, underscoring the urgent need for better protective measures and support systems in place for those affected by domestic violence. His comments reflect a growing awareness of the systemic issues surrounding domestic abuse and the impact it has not just on victims, but also on law enforcement tasked with managing these crises.
